Transaction 3c595424589a74a1dafb67747956aee6fcdfc5032463b3978cf4d9003bff5b8a
1 Input
1 Output
-
3c595424589a74a1dafb67747956aee6fcdfc5032463b3978cf4d9003bff5b8a:0
- value
- 1428010
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5a46198fb0a40a63df6334974526ccfc3c32d51 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LUdrGavGro2MwxNanP61Gck4TWHDRht7f